The RLC Residences’ IRONKIDS Davao duathlon is set to take place tomorrow at the Bago Aplaya Esplanade along Davao City Coastal Road.
The event, serving as the junior edition of an international triathlon series, will feature children aged 6 to 15 competing in swim and run segments.
A total of 450 participants are expected, nearly double the number from last year’s race.
IRONKIDS Davao aims to develop young talent and promote the growth of the Philippine triathlon.
The event also serves as a prelude to the IRONMAN 70.3 Davao happening this Sunday.
